Overhead Homelink Wiring

2016 ILX, base package. We just helped my SIL purchase it and I'm disappointed that it does not have a built in Homelink (and poor audio quality, but that's for another topic).

I purchased an overhead maplight unit with the built in homelink HONBBHL4 module seen here: https://fccid.io/CB2HONBBHL4/Interna...photos-1559111

I'm used to homelink modules using three wires (Power, Ground, Illumination), however this unit requires its own 8 pin connector, which does NOT come standard on the base model ILX, much to my dismay.

Where would I be able to find a pinout to power up the module? I do not understand why it needs anything more than Power/Ground to work.

Originally Posted by DaIll1
I unplugged the ANC (active noise cancelation) device over the glove compartment and it made a huge difference. It uses the sound system to pump in fake exhaust sound and the speakers are so busy creating it that it looses sound quality.
It's not fake engine or exhaust sound, it's the "anti" sound waves to cancel out low frequency noise. Debatable how well it works but typically a cheap method to reduce interior noise when a car doesn't have much sound deadening materials.
